112 | config 8xx_CPU6 | |
113 | bool "CPU6 Silicon Errata (860 Pre Rev. C)" | |
114 | help | |
115 | MPC860 CPUs, prior to Rev C have some bugs in the silicon, which | |
116 | require workarounds for Linux (and most other OSes to work). If you | |
117 | get a BUG() very early in boot, this might fix the problem. For | |
118 | more details read the document entitled "MPC860 Family Device Errata | |
c8a55f3d | 119 | Reference" on Freescale's website. This option also incurs a |
14cf11af PM |
120 | performance hit. |
121 | ||
122 | If in doubt, say N here. | |
123 | ||
74016852 SW |
124 | config 8xx_CPU15 |
125 | bool "CPU15 Silicon Errata" | |
126 | default y | |
127 | help | |
128 | This enables a workaround for erratum CPU15 on MPC8xx chips. | |
129 | This bug can cause incorrect code execution under certain | |
130 | circumstances. This workaround adds some overhead (a TLB miss | |
131 | every time execution crosses a page boundary), and you may wish | |
132 | to disable it if you have worked around the bug in the compiler | |
133 | (by not placing conditional branches or branches to LR or CTR | |
134 | in the last word of a page, with a target of the last cache | |
135 | line in the next page), or if you have used some other | |
136 | workaround. | |
137 | ||
138 | If in doubt, say Y here. | |
